Aleksander Emelianenko converts to Islam, publicly apologizes to Fedor Emelianenko

Fedor Emelianenko celebrated his 47th birthday on September 28. On this special occasion, his brother Aleksander Emelianenko took a unique approach to convey his wishes – through a heartfelt video message.

Aleksander Emelianenko, who is also a seasoned mixed martial artist with a noteworthy career, appeared in the video with a strikingly different appearance. Sporting a long beard and holding an electronic rosary, he conveyed his birthday greetings to his younger brother, Fedor.

However, Aleksander’s message carried a deeper significance. In the video, he took the opportunity to extend a sincere apology to Fedor for any past troubles he may have caused.

“Fedor, my brother, I congratulate you on your birthday. I wish you all the blessings of the world and the grace of God. I want to apologize to you… Apologize for the fact that I upset you with my behavior, my actions, and my wrong way of life,” Aleksander Emelianenko expressed genuinely.

He went on to share that he is currently undergoing rehabilitation at the Iman Personal Restoration Center in Ingushetia, focusing on his recovery from detrimental habits and actions. Aleksander emphasized that his newfound sobriety serves as his birthday gift to Fedor.

“Now, I’m in Ingushetia at the Iman Personal Restoration Center. I am undergoing rehabilitation here, recovering from my harmful and hurtful actions and habits. Let my sobriety be your birthday gift. Happy birthday to you,” he added, demonstrating his commitment to turning over a new leaf.

Aleksander Emelianenko’s journey has been marked by ups and downs in the world of mixed martial arts. He achieved recognition in promotions like Pride FC, where he faced formidable opponents such as Mirko Cro Cop and Josh Barnett. However, his career took a different turn when he faced legal troubles.

In 2015, he was convicted, resulting in a 4.5-year prison sentence. He was granted parole in 2016 but faced further legal issues in 2019 when he was arrested for DUI and other related charges, including resisting arrest and insulting authorities.
